Ecoflow Delta 2 max extra battery (no inverter, need Delta 2 or Delta 2 max main inverter to work)

This extra battery will add additional 2kwh of battery to extend your usage time.

Bad price even on a $/Wh metric ($0.371/Wh) alone. Factor into the proprietary lock-in (EF has even moved to prevent this from being used with other power stations like the Delta Pro) and the older design, it is definitely not worth it. Plus the head unit (Delta 2 Max) has horrendous self-consumption and poor AC efficiency.

At $500, maybe worth buying.

My setup?


No not really but you can Google the idea. The solar inputs are just DC inputs. So you can connect cheap LiFEPO4 batteries to them to give you more run time instead of solar panels. You can buy the right three pin xt60i connectors off Amazon that tell the ecoflow to pull max current (so it thinks it's solar not a cars 12v cigarette socket). 12v batteries will limit you a bit. Better to get the 24v/36v or 48v version like I didnfor max power transfer.
